Position Summary

The Quality Engineer II plays a critical role in ensuring product and process quality by applying statistical and analytical methods to assess quality performance and cost-of-quality. This position is responsible for developing and implementing inspection, testing, and evaluation procedures to guarantee the precision, reliability, and accuracy of products and production equipment.

Key responsibilities include establishing and maintaining quality systems, inspection plans, and technical quality documentation to ensure compliance with project requirements and contracts. The Quality Engineer II conducts thorough analyses to identify non-conforming products or materials, assigns responsibility, and collaborates with product development teams to provide quality input.

This role involves monitoring quality trends, coordinating corrective actions with customers and suppliers, and performing in-house and supplier audits to ensure adherence to quality standards. Additionally, the Quality Engineer II develops programs to enhance supplier performance, prepares detailed quality reports, and evaluates proposed changes in materials or methods.

The position also includes compiling training materials and delivering training sessions on quality control activities to support continuous improvement and maintain high-quality standards across the organization.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ree (BS) in Engineering or a related discipline.
  • Demonstrated ability to perform the essential functions of the job typically acquired through two or more years of related experience.
  • American Society for Quality certification desired.
  • Thorough knowledge of state-of-the-art inspection and quality inspection and quality engineering/assurance techniques, procedures, instruments, equipment, theories, principles and concepts and general business operations.
  • Ability to effectively assess and implement continuous improvement techniques to quality and manufacturing functions.
  • Ability to use standard business applications software and/or specialized data analysis tools.
  • Ability to establish goals and objectives to complete projects.
  • Ability to effectively communicate and present information to team members, team leaders and top management.
  • 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ts and draw valid conclusions.
  • Ability to effectively demonstrate team member competencies and participate in goal setting, performance feedback and self-development

activities.

  • Six Sigma and Lean tools experience is desired.
  • Experience in maintaining and improving QS9000/ISO900 and TSI6949 Systems is desired.
